Service First Mortgage is currently hiring for a Team Loan Officer.

The Team Loan Officer provides assistance to a designated Loan Officer in originating and processing loans. Duties include:

  • Following up on leads for potential borrowers
  • Assisting the Loan Officer in pre-qualifying potential borrowers
  • Coordinating receipt of a complete and accurate loan application package
  • Communicating effectively and quickly to all parties, both internally and externally, about timelines and expectations to ensure all loans close on time
  • Following up with borrowers for items needed for loan submission
  • Execution of disclosures and submission of loan file for processing
  • Manage the Loan Officer(s) calendar, including follow-up, appointment setting and time blocking as appropriate.
  • Manage the CRM, including follow-ups with warm leads and closed loans.
  • Pipeline management, including scheduled pipeline reviews, daily tracking and weekly status calls to customers.
  • Utilization of designated Sales tools and reporting methods

Requirements

  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• 4+ years of mortgage experience or related sales position.
  • Knowledge and understanding of the lending process, federal and state law, and various loan products and guidelines.
  • NMLS License required.
